I go back to what Trent Dilfer said two days ago and he called. He said that that Carson Wentz has the superman mentality. I heard that, yes, sir, I heard that he had the superman mentality that he wants to And it's a good thing, um, but it sometimes gets in the way
of rational thinking what you should do right right? Instead of saying, you know what I'm gonna I want to force this ball? Now, do I have the arm talent to do it? And this is This is not just what Carson. This was a lot of guys. You have arm talent, John Elway, Dan Marino, Joe Montana, Steve you know. I mean, the list goes on and on and on and on and on. Guys who have this supreme arm talent or this talented arm Jay Cutler, guys like that. What happens is mentally, you know that I have the
ability to make any in every throw. I have the arm power to fit balls in where they shouldn't go. The difference is who. There's two parts to this. One do I have guys on the other end that can help me? Two? Do I know when and where to be Superman? Because sometimes Clark Kent is what you need. Clark Kent is, Hey, let's give the ball to Savings
in this checkdown and let him run. We don't have to we don't have to go Superman and fit it down the field twenty yards for a potential interception, a tip ball or drop pass, and now we're looking to punk or turn the ball over. So having that mentality of I can rip open my shirt and I had this on my attention with this arm that I have, or button up the suit, put the glasses on and just be Clark Kent. So for Carson Wentz, it's something to worry about because he has the ability to be Superman.
Where we have to capitalize is when he's Superman, when Clark Kent should have been the option be Kryptonite, be Kryptonite. And what he doesn't have at his leisure right now is credible receivers.
